Allow different payment and shipping options

Assignment Help Basic Computer Science
Reference no: EM13166103

Software System:

Assume that you are assigned with the task of building an online bookstore. The initial contact with the customer revealed that this web site should allow their users to search for books in a number of different ways, maintain lists of books with potential buying interest (e.g., wishlist and preorder list), rate and review books they buy, order books online and check the order status,

allow different payment and shipping options. There are a plenty of examples of this kind of web sites. Some well-known ones are amazon.com, Barnes & Nobles, and Borders.

Roles:

Assume roles and responsibilities of both the customer and development organizations.

Tasks:

Identify and document user stories. Assuming the project follows an agile method and is in an initial requirements gathering phase. You are required to do the following:

Identify at least five user stories (5) and write them in the "index card" like format .

Provide a project estimate of the time (in days) needed to build the web site. Clearly document your process of estimation.

An iteration plan for the releases. Assume a timeboxed iteration with a duration of no more than 21 workdays.

Clearly document any 'big stories' that you may identify and how you would resolve them.

Clearly document the assumptions and how you tacked them. Which ones stayed as risks?

Evaluation:

(remember your customer "writes" your requirements, and stay away from what you think your customer needs or wants)

 

 

Reference no: EM13166103

Questions Cloud

State draw the fischer projection of the enantiomer : Draw the Fischer projection of the enantiomer of (4S, 5S)-5-sec-butyl-4-(1,1-difluoromethyl)nonane
What is the vapor pressure of the stored mixture : The solvent for an organic reaction is prepared by mixing 60.0 of acetone () with 56.0 of ethyl acetate (). This mixture is stored at 25.0 . The vapor pressure and the densities for the two pure components at 25.0. What is the vapor pressure of th..
Write a c++ program to draw the five olympic rings : Write a C++ program to draw the five Olympic rings. Make the circles have a thickness of 5 pixel
Write a script that declares a variable : Write a script that declares a variable and sets it to the count of all products in the Products table. If the count is greater than or equal to 7, the script should display a message that says,
Allow different payment and shipping options : allow different payment and shipping options. There are a plenty of examples of this kind of web sites. Some well-known ones are amazon.com, Barnes & Nobles, and Borders.
How does one ensure that a cost-management system : Toni is relying on financial feedback, and the product costing method adopted by the large bakery. What are the strengths and weaknesses of these approaches?
Demand-paged environment : Which of the following programming techniques and data structures (in a user-level program) are good for a demand-paged environment, and which are bad? Explain your answer.
State what temperature should cool the air : If you want to remove 50% of the moisture in the air at a constant pressure of 100 kPa, to what temperature should you cool the air.
Explain what is the residence times of these solutes : Using the data given below, calculate the residence times of the solutes in seawater. The amount of water flowing from rivers to oceans = 3.74 x 10^19 g yr-1 , and the amount of water in oceans = 1.35 x 10^24. What is the residence times of these ..

Reviews

Write a Review

Basic Computer Science Questions & Answers

  Identifies the cost of computer

identifies the cost of computer components to configure a computer system (including all peripheral devices where needed) for use in one of the following four situations:

  Input devices

Compare how the gestures data is generated and represented for interpretation in each of the following input devices. In your comparison, consider the data formats (radio waves, electrical signal, sound, etc.), device drivers, operating systems suppo..

  Cores on computer systems

Assignment : Cores on Computer Systems:  Differentiate between multiprocessor systems and many-core systems in terms of power efficiency, cost benefit analysis, instructions processing efficiency, and packaging form factors.

  Prepare an annual budget in an excel spreadsheet

Prepare working solutions in Excel that will manage the annual budget

  Write a research paper in relation to a software design

Research paper in relation to a Software Design related topic

  Describe the forest, domain, ou, and trust configuration

Describe the forest, domain, OU, and trust configuration for Bluesky. Include a chart or diagram of the current configuration. Currently Bluesky has a single domain and default OU structure.

  Construct a truth table for the boolean expression

Construct a truth table for the Boolean expressions ABC + A'B'C' ABC + AB'C' + A'B'C' A(BC' + B'C)

  Evaluate the cost of materials

Evaluate the cost of materials

  The marie simulator

Depending on how comfortable you are with using the MARIE simulator after reading

  What is the main advantage of using master pages

What is the main advantage of using master pages. Explain the purpose and advantage of using styles.

  Describe the three fundamental models of distributed systems

Explain the two approaches to packet delivery by the network layer in Distributed Systems. Describe the three fundamental models of Distributed Systems

  Distinguish between caching and buffering

Distinguish between caching and buffering The failure model defines the ways in which failure may occur in order to provide an understanding of the effects of failure. Give one type of failure with a brief description of the failure

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d